01. Why choose composite decking?

Composite decking has numerous advantages over other decking materials, particularly timber. All Vale & Eden deck boards are:

  • Highly durable

Our boards are resistant to insect infestation, rotting, warping, and decaying.

  • Safe and practical

By nature, the boards don’t splinter, so you can feel confident to walk on them barefoot. They’re also highly slip-resistant, but we do offer them with anti-slip inserts for extra peace of mind.

  • Fade resistant

During the first three months after installation, the boards will change slightly in colour as they acclimatise to your environment. After three months, they will remain the same, consistent tone all year-round. That’s no matter the intensity of the sunlight or weather.

  • Simple to maintain

Keeping a composite deck looking as good as new is straightforward. Unlike timber boards, composite doesn’t need to be stained, painted, or oiled. A simple sweep and wash is enough to maintain its charm.

  • A more sustainable choice

All of our decking is manufactured in Britain from sustainably-sourced or recycled materials.

04. What are your deck boards made from?

We’re proud to manufacture our wood composite boards from 95% recycled and sustainably-sourced raw materials.

Approximately 60% of the material in our boards is sustainably-sourced wood fibre, which is certified by the Programme for the Endorsement of Forest Certification (PEFC). We have held this PEFC/16-37-1226 Chain of Custody certification since 2011 to show that we can trace these wood fibres back to responsibly and sustainably managed forests.

Recycled HDPE polymer makes up around 35% of the materials in the boards – this is recycled plastic from consumer waste, such as bottles and containers.

By combining the wood flour with the polymer pellets and then extruding it, we’re able to produce our wood polymer composite boards.

07. What materials do you use for the decking subframe?

It totally depends on the design, scale, and size of your deck. We use structural systems of the highest quality and durability to ensure your deck has strength and stability for ultimate longevity. Usually, we design and fit subframes using composite and aluminium structures because of their robust integrity. Sometimes, we use timber – but this is usually for projects where a timber subframe is already in place or due to the personal preference of the customer.
